Where We Stand on Natural Resources Policy

When you make your living on the land like everyone in the cattle business does, policy decisions that impact our natural resources are critically important. On this episode, Director of NCBA Government Affairs and the Public Lands Council Garrett Edmonds joins to share the latest information on natural resources policy in Washington. Edmonds updates listeners on the status of presidential confirmations for officials nominated to lead key land management agencies, provides information on the newly reintroduced Black Vulture Relief Act, and shares insights from recent legislative fly-ins in Washington.
